Senior Backend Developer (Node.js / NestJS)
About Evolutio
Evolutio is building a modern cloud platform for ophthalmology clinics across the UK. Our software is used by consultants, optometrists and healthcare professionals to manage patient care, referrals, imaging, communications and clinical workflows.
We're replacing legacy healthcare systems with modern cloud software built using TypeScript, Node.js, Angular and AWS.
This is an opportunity to join a small, highly experienced engineering team where you'll have significant influence over architecture and technical direction.
The Role
This is an office-based position in our Reading, Berkshire office with travel required to our Irish Dev Team based in Sligo. Remote working is not available.
We're looking for an experienced backend developer who enjoys solving difficult engineering problems rather than simply delivering tickets.
You'll work closely with the founders and other developers to design and build scalable APIs, security features and cloud services that support thousands of clinical users.
You'll have genuine input into architecture and technology decisions.
What you'll work on
- Designing and developing REST APIs using Node.js and NestJS
- Building secure authentication and authorisation systems
- AWS cloud architecture
- Performance optimisation
- Database design and optimisation
- Integrating with external healthcare systems and APIs
- Code reviews and mentoring
- Designing new platform features from scratch
Our Technology
- Node.js
- NestJS
- TypeScript
- Oracle
- AWS
- Docker
- Git
- JWT / OAuth
- REST APIs
Experience with every technology isn't essential.
We're looking for someone who has
- 5+ years commercial backend development
- Excellent JavaScript/TypeScript
- Strong Node.js experience
- Experience building production APIs
- Excellent SQL skills
- Experience designing scalable systems
- Strong debugging and problem-solving ability
- Good communication skills
Desirable:
- NestJS
- AWS
- Healthcare experience
- Oracle
- Security experience
What we offer
- Competitive salary
- Small engineering team
- Direct influence over product direction
- Modern technology stack
- Long-term product development (not consultancy)
- Interesting technical challenges
- Office-based role in Reading town centre with travel to our Irish office in Sligo.